Liverpool have already made their first moves of the summer transfer window before the market has even officially opened.
Jeremie Frimpong was on Merseyside on Monday for a medical as the Bayer Leverkusen defender closes in on a £30m move to Liverpool, with the Reds also starting work on signing Milos Kerkez after a breakout season at AFC Bournemouth.
As well as signings, players are expected to leave Anfield over the off-season, with Federico Chiesa likely to leave Liverpool having failed to make much of an impact for the Reds just one year after joining from Juventus.
And another Liverpool player is now attracting interest from both the Premier League and the Bundesliga.

According to Sky Germany journalist Florian Plettenberg, clubs are ‘showing interest’ in signing Jarell Quansah, who Liverpool could be convinced to sell this summer if a suitable offer were to be made for the England international.
Plettenburg wrote: “Understand several Bundesliga clubs and teams from England are showing interest in Jarell Quansah!
A sale of the 22-year-old centre-back this summer is not ruled out”
Newcastle United are one side who have been linked with Quansah in recent weeks as Liverpool continue to weigh up whether or not the academy graduate should leave for good this summer amid building interest.

And with teams from Germany now in the mix for Quansah, there’s a real chance that the Liverpool defender could be on a move if a convincing enough offer comes in for the centre-back, especially with the Reds in need of raising some funds over the window.
With Quansah once being hailed as ‘outstanding’ by Jurgen Klopp, there’s an obvious reason why clubs are interested in signing the young defender, even if his performances this season haven’t exactly set the world alight.
And with Liverpool interested in signing Jorrel Hato, finding a suitor for Quansah could help the Reds fund a move for the Ajax wonderkid, who could be a better fit for Arne Slot’s squad going into the new season.
Indeed, Premier League and Bundesliga interest will help Liverpool get as much value as possible out of selling Quansah, and the defender himself could be keen on a new challenge away from Anfield if a tempting enough offer were to be made.
